Official Coding Guidelines

Acute respiratory failure as principal diagnosis

b. Acute Respiratory Failure 1) Acute respiratory failure as principal diagnosis A code from subcategory J96.0, Acute respiratory failure, or subcategory J96.2, Acute and chronic respiratory failure, may be assigned as a principal diagnosis when it is the condition established after study to be chiefly responsible for occasioning the admission to the hospital, and the selection is supported by the Alphabetic Index and Tabular List. However, chapter- specific coding guidelines (such as obstetrics, poisoning, HIV, newborn) that provide sequencing direction take precedence.

— ICD-10-CM Official Guidelines for Coding and Reporting, FY2026, Section I.C.10.b.1
Acute respiratory failure due to COVID-19: U07.1 + J96.0-

(v) Acute respiratory failure For acute respiratory failure due to COVID-19, assign code U07.1, and code J96.0-, Acute respiratory failure.

— ICD-10-CM Official Guidelines for Coding and Reporting, FY2026, Section I.C.1.g.1.c.(v)
